如何按第一个STL列表

时间:2016-02-25 21:49:52

标签: c++ stl

如果我将几个水果名称推回到第一个STL列表,同时,我将每个水果的数量推回到第二个STL列表中; 如果我想按字母顺序对第一个STL列表进行排序,我该如何按水果STL列表的顺序对第二个STL列表进行排序?

1 个答案:

答案 0 :(得分:0)

您可以使用std::map

  

使用比较功能比较来对键进行排序。

或者您sort之后会有一个名称+金额pairs的列表,其中包含自定义比较功能(std::string支持std::lexicographical_compare)。